NCT ID: NCT07302906
Description: De-identified individual participant data (IPD) underlying the main published results may be shared with other researchers upon reasonable request to the principal investigator and after approval by the Hospital de ClĂ­nicas/UFPR data governance. The study protocol and statistical analysis plan will be made available as supplementary material. The analytic code (e.g., R/Python scripts) used for data cleaning and analysis will be deposited in a public Git repository (such as GitHub) after publication of the primary results.
Study: NCT07302906
Study Brief: Randomized Trial of an Ambient AI Scribe (Voa Health) That Converts Outpatient Visit Audio Into Draft Notes, Comparing Visits With vs. Without AI Across Multiple Clinics to Assess Physician Well-being, Documentation Burden and Patient Experience.
